importjava.util.Scanner;publicclassGAGA{publicstaticvoidmain(String args[]){ Scanner input=newScanner(System.in);//提示输入System.out.print("Enter ten numbers: ");int[] a =newint[10];for(inti = 0; i < 10; i++) { a[i]=input.nextInt(); }//筛选System.out.print("The distinct nu...
步骤1:创建一个数组 int[]array={1,2,2,3,3,3}; 1. 在这里,我们创建了一个包含相同数据的数组。这里我们使用了整型数组,你也可以根据实际情况选择其他类型的数组。 步骤2:从数组中选取相同的数据 List<Integer>list=newArrayList<>();for(intnum:array){if(Collections.frequency(list,num)<2){list.add(...
在主程序中,我们创建一个整数数组并传递给printCombinations方法。 在printCombinations方法中,我们调用了一个重载的私有方法printCombinations,该方法具有三个参数:数组、当前索引和组合字符串。递归终止条件是当当前索引等于数组长度时,打印组合字符串。在迭代数组元素时,我们将当前元素添加到组合字符串中,并使用递归调用更...
正文 1 #include <iostream> #include <string> #include <fstream> using namespace std; int count=0; void countNum(int a[],int start,int finish) { //cout<<start<<" \n"<<finish<<"\n"; int middle=(start+finish)/2; if(start>finish) return ; if(a[middle]...
方法一:将第一个数组的元素放到哈希表中,将第二个数组的元素也往哈希表中放,通过对比是否相同就可以判定那些元素是否需要保留。方法二:将第一个数组当做查找源,将第二元素当做查找对象,采用二分查找法,逐个查找存在查找对象。
Java8排列组合 List<String>list=Arrays.asList(newString[]{"1","2","3","4"});System.out....
public static void main(String[] args) { int[] a = new int[100];for(int i=1;i<=100...
}else{//这里,控制从最左边开始,一旦遇到不同元素,则跳出break; } }returnnum; }publicstaticvoidmain(String[] args) {String[] a= { "1","1","1","0" }; String[] b = { "1","1","1","1" };System.out.println(stringArrayCompare(a, b)); ...
亲亲您好,Java编写一个程序,从键盘输入若干个单词,保存在数组中,输出数组中所有元素,可以参考以下的代码示例:import java.util.Scanner; //导入Scanner类,用于从键盘输入数据public class WordArray { //定义一个类,类名为WordArray public static void main(String[] args) { //定义主方法 ...
import java.util.Set;/ author wsj / public class Test1 { public static void main(String[] args) { Integer arr[]={1,2,3,4,5,6,7,8,9,0};int count=5;Set<Integer> set=select(arr, count);for (Integer i:set) { System.out.println(i);} } public static Set<Integer> ...